Sharp Dishwasher Error Code E6
Thermal sensor open circuit (cut)
What the E6 error code actually means
The E6 code means your dishwasher's water temperature sensor has stopped working, likely because it has failed or a wire connected to it has broken. This sensor is what tells the dishwasher how hot the water is during a cycle. This code only shows up during a special service test mode, not during regular use.

Most common causes of E6
- 1Failed thermal sensor (thermistor)
- 2Broken or damaged sensor wiring harness
- 3Corroded or disconnected connector terminals
- 4Extreme inlet water temperature
